It really is true that what goes around, comes back around (to quote beloved Justin Timberlake), and in true throwback style, the divisive tie-dye print is resurfacing. Maybe it's because we're all going through our wardrobes and digging out old t-shirts and jumpers, or maybe it really is just 'cool' again. We'll never know. But what is for certain is that it never ages, and still looks just as good as it did when our parents rocked it in the '60s and '70s - in my opinion anyway. Like I said, it's a real love-or-hate pattern. However, this style is so versatile and lends itself from being paired back with a classic pair of jeans, dressed up with a midi dress or simply on loungewear for chilling in the house.


Not only does tie-dye have that laid-back-just-woke-up-like-this vibe to it, it's also pretty chic (believe it or not) and before we were shut in, influencers were spotted in it all over the streets. You can also make them yourself, which, given the current state of the world, is a pretty fun way to spend an afternoon. If you're not into getting in touch with your inner hippy, the good old high street (online, of course) has a selection of totally rad '90s prints.
